导读:
LNMP是一种常用的Web服务器架构,包含Linux、Nginx、MySQL和PHP四个组件。而Redis则是一种高性能的内存数据库,可以作为缓存或消息队列使用。本文将介绍如何在LNMP中安装Redis扩展,以提升系统性能和稳定性。
1. 安装Redis
首先需要安装Redis数据库,可以通过源码编译或者直接下载二进制文件进行安装。安装完成后,启动Redis服务。
2. 安装Redis扩展
在安装PHP时需要加入--with-redis参数,即可编译安装Redis扩展。如果已经安装了PHP,可以通过PECL命令来安装Redis扩展。
3. 配置Nginx
在Nginx配置文件中添加以下内容:
location /redis {
fastcgi_pass 127.0.0.1:9000;
fastcgi_param REDIS_HOST "127.0.0.1";
fastcgi_param REDIS_PORT "6379";
}
这样就可以通过访问来访问Redis数据库了。
4. 编写测试程序
最后可以编写一个简单的测试程序,来验证Redis扩展是否正常工作。
$redis = new Redis();
$redis->connect('127.0.0.1', 6379);
$redis->set('test', 'Hello World!');
echo $redis->get('test');
?>
运行该程序,应该可以看到输出“Hello World!”。
总结:
通过安装Redis扩展,可以在LNMP架构中使用高性能的内存数据库,提升系统性能和稳定性。安装步骤包括安装Redis、安装Redis扩展、配置Nginx和编写测试程序。希望本文对大家有所帮助。